Output 5058086ed0f5672040cfdd2660c9e2d771956d600975ec9700986353c5c1e44f:40

value
100506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2de98dd6538cf540968435294b3a356e1c0b12c OP_EQUAL
address
3GYC3wU4CUE32Lj1AkrvuQzwvJTGka1UsY
transaction
5058086ed0f5672040cfdd2660c9e2d771956d600975ec9700986353c5c1e44f
spent
true